Mi hai
You have
Language note: Refers to something done by the listener.
Word-by-Word Breakdown
Mi
[mee]
to me
Used to indicate the indirect object of a verb.
Mi hai detto tutto.
You told me everything.
hai
[ahee]
you have
Form used to indicate possession or an action completed by the subject.
Mi hai aiutato molto.
You have helped me a lot.
